Q: Do credit card companies commonly file civil cases?

Can you be arrested for not paying your credit cards in Ga?

Credit card debt can result in civil suits, loss of credit, and in some cases denial of services. But you would only face arrest if you wrote a bad check to pay the bills.

What kinds of cases are considered to be civil cases?

All cases that are not criminal are civil. When two private parties have a dispute, it is civil. When one party is charged with a crime by the state, it is criminal.

What types of crimes eg.criminal or civil are most commonly reported in the newspapers and why?

In newspapers, criminal offenses such as murders, robberies, and drug-related crimes are commonly reported due to their sensational nature and public interest. Civil cases, such as disputes over contracts or property, are less likely to make headlines unless they involve prominent individuals or high-profile companies. Criminal cases tend to attract more attention from readers due to the impact on public safety and the potential for dramatic narratives.
